What happend during the easrer rising?

The Easter rising was a protest by the people of Ireland against British rule. The uprising occurred during the Easter week of 1916 and was organised by the Irish Republican Brotherhood. During the uprising, key locations in Dublin were seized

When was the Easter Uprising in ireland?

On Easter Monday in 1916, the Easter rising began. Easter Monday was on the 24th of April in 1916. The rising lasted until the 30th of April 1916.
